Des Moines Shoreline Master Program<br />

Area of special flood hazard 3 . The land within a flood plain subject to a one percent or greater<br />

chance of flooding in any given year. These areas include, but are not limited to, streams, rivers,<br />

lakes, coastal areas, and wetlands.<br />

Apartment 3 . A room, or a suite of two or more rooms in a multiple dwelling or in any other<br />

building not a single-family dwelling or a duplex dwelling occupied or suitable for occupancy as<br />

a dwelling unit for one family.<br />

Apartment hotel 3 . A building containing dwelling units and six or more hotel rooms or suites.<br />

Apartment house 3 . A building or a portion of a building, designed for occupancy by three or<br />

more families living separately from each other and containing three or more dwelling units.<br />

Appeal, closed record 1 . As defined by RCW 36.70B.020(1), a “closed record appeal” means an<br />

appeal of a land use action following an open record public hearing on a proposed land use<br />

action. Such an appeal is on the record established during the open record pre-decision public<br />

hearing with no new evidence or information allowed. During a closed record appeal, only<br />

appeal argument is allowed.<br />

Appeal, open record 3 . An appeal related to an open record public hearing held prior to a<br />

decision on a proposed land use action . An open record hearing may be held on an appeal, to be<br />

known as an “open record appeal hearing” if no open record pre-decision hearing has been held<br />

on the land use action.<br />

Aquifer 3 . A consolidated or unconsolidated ground water-bearing geologic formation or<br />

formations that contain enough saturated permeable material to yield significant quantities of<br />

water to wells.<br />

Bank 2 . A steep rise or slope at the edge of a body of water or water course.<br />

Beach nourishment 2 . The artificial replenishing of a beach by delivery of materials dredged or<br />

excavated elsewhere.<br />

Berm 2 . A ledge or shoulder consisting of mounded earth or rock.<br />

Bluff 3 . A steep slope which abuts and rises from Puget Sound. Bluffs contain slopes<br />

predominantly in excess of 40 percent, although portions may be less than 40 percent. The toe of<br />

the bluff is the beach of Puget Sound. The top of a bluff is typically a distinct line where the<br />

slope abruptly levels out. Where there is no distinct break in slope, the slope is either the line of<br />

vegetation separating the unvegetated slope from the vegetated uplands plateau or, when the<br />

bluff is vegetated, the point where the bluff slope diminishes to less than 15 percent.<br />

Boathouse, private 3 . An accessory building, or portion of building, which provides shelter and<br />

enclosure for a boat or boats owned and operated only by the occupants of the premises.<br />

Boathouse Public 3 . A boathouse other than a private boathouse, used for the care, repair, or<br />

storage of boats, or where such boats are kept for remuneration, hire, or sale.<br />

KEY: 1. RCW or WAC 2. 1988 SMP Glossary 3. City Zoning Code 4. New Definition<br />

Department of Ecology approval effective November 1, 2010<br />
